New Delhi: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L), a Navratna Defence Public Sector Undertaking, has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with VVDN Technologies Pvt. Ltd. to collaborate on the joint development and manufacturing of Wi-Fi and 5G-based networking subsystems, reinforcing the push towards self-reliance in defence and professional electronics.
The MoU marks a strategic partnership aimed at leveraging the technological capabilities of both entities to accelerate indigenous design, development, and production of advanced communication systems. The partnership will focus on several key areas, including Wi-Fi and 5G-based networking subsystems, software and networking solutions, radar technologies, and naval systems, along with applications in the railways and other critical sectors.
The agreement was formally exchanged by BEL's Chairman & Managing Director (CMD) Manoj Jain and Co-Founder and President of VVDN Technologies Vivek Bansal.
BEL, a leading aerospace and defence electronics company, brings decades of expertise in mission-critical systems for the Indian Armed Forces. VVDN, a global provider of product engineering and manufacturing services, contributes its strength in electronics design and software development.
This collaboration is aligned with the Government of India’s vision of Aatmanirbhar Bharat, aiming to reduce import dependency by promoting indigenous manufacturing in strategic sectors such as defence and communications.
